Job Description

An Exciting Opportunity for ...

> Assisting the collaboration works with key internal and external stakeholders of the Company and Partners. Drive for the development and execution of actions and plans that are consistent with the strategic framework and objectives of the organization and aligned with other business strategies.

> Communicate with Media (TV, Radio, Newspapers, Magazines etc.) and Agents (Advertising companies, Consultants) to execute Corporate Communication activities. 

> Make press releases and prepare Q&A, communicating with relevant business lines and PR agents. 

> Arrange interviews & speeches for management exposure with Media and draft speeches. 

> Plan and execute PR activities/campaigns in accordance with the guideline and supervision of senior management.

> Assist monitoring and evaluation of PR works during and after the project timeline

> Working with the manager to plan and deliver effective internal communications and engagement plans.

> Research and gather opportunities for sponsorships and work with related departments to ensure match with the corporate brand.

> Make annual roadmap for events, media meetings linking with PR/CSR activities for the better communications.

Job Requirements

> Fluent in English and Burmese (both speaking and written communications) with strong editing and proof-reading skills

> Experience in working for Public Relations, CSR, and / or NGO / NPO related activities 

> Good communication skills 

> Computer Skills (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int)

> Self-motivated with the drive and perseverance to work on own initiative as well as working within a team environment

> Understanding of digital technologies used in communications

> A visionary, creative, strategic thinker and self-starter who is proactive.

> Ability to establish and meet deadlines; ability to establish clear priorities quickly
> Ability to understand challenges or underlying concerns, share ideas and develop effective responses 

> Ability to work under pressure with multitasking skills is a must. 

> Adapt with cross culture business environment and work collaboratively within team and outside organization.
